(A) A physician may be certified by the board as an EMS instructor if the physician meets the following criteria:
(1) Is an active medical director with an EMS agency, who meets the requirements set forth in rule 4765-3-05 of the Administrative Code, or is recommended by the local RPAB, or is recommended by the program director or program medical director of an accredited or approved training institution;
(2) Submits a completed application approved by the board;
(3) Holds a current and valid Ohio license to practice medicine and surgery or osteopathic medicine and surgery that is in good standing;
(4) Is in compliance with the requirements set forth in paragraphs (A)(6) to (A)(12) of rule 4765-8-01 of the Administrative Code.
(B) A physician may renew their certificate to teach as an EMS instructor if the physician submits an application approved by the board which demonstrates continued compliance with the requirements listed in paragraph (A) of this rule. The physician is not required to complete the renewal requirements set forth in paragraphs (A)(5) to (A)(6) of rule 4765-18-06 of the Administrative Code.
(C) A physician who chooses to enroll in an EMS instructor training program is exempt from meeting the requirements set forth in rule 4765-18-03 of the Administrative Code.
